SummervsMedusa

Summer and Medusa are popular aroma hops. Below you'll find a comparison of alpha and beta acids, aroma profiles and oil composition.

Key differences

When to pick Summer

  • Higher alpha acid - stronger bittering
  • More essential oils - more intense aroma

When to pick Medusa

  • More myrcene - pronounced citrus and resinous notes
